Tom Dundon, the proprietor of NHL side Carolina Hurricanes, has finalised his acquisition of the Portland Trail Blazers in a historic deal that signals the end of an era for the storied NBA side. The deal, valued at around $4.25 billion (£3.21 billion), sees Dundon take the helm as the team’s governor, with the Trail Blazers staying based in Portland. The sale ends a stretch of stewardship by the holdings of Paul Allen, the Microsoft co-founder who purchased the team in 1988 and died in 2018. All revenue from the sale will fund Allen’s charitable endeavours, representing a major transition for one of basketball’s most storied institutions.

The Transaction and Its Impact

The completion of this deal represents a turning point for the Portland Trail Blazers, ending almost 40 years of ownership by the Allen family. Paul Allen’s purchase of the team from founder Larry Weinberg for $70 million in 1988 had established the billionaire as a custodian of one of the NBA’s most prestigious organisations. His passing in 2018 required a management phase by his estate, which ultimately determined that a disposal would best serve both the team’s prospects and Allen’s philanthropic legacy. The decision to put the team on the market last May opened the door for new ownership to take the reins.

Dundon’s dedication to the Portland fanbase demonstrates an intent to overturn the franchise’s recent struggles and restore competitive excellence. The billionaire entrepreneur, who has shown investment acumen through his stewardship of the Carolina Hurricanes, inherits a team facing major obstacles both on and off the court. His pledge to be “relentless towards building a team that can compete at the top tier, every single season” constitutes a bold statement of intent. With the Trail Blazers presently set for the play-in tournament under acting head coach Tiago Splitter, the new ownership era arrives at a pivotal juncture for the club.

  • Allen bought the Trail Blazers for $70 million in 1988
  • The franchise’s sole NBA championship was won in 1977
  • Dundon also operates the NHL’s Carolina Hurricanes franchise
  • All sale proceeds fund Paul Allen’s philanthropic efforts

A Storied Franchise History

The Portland Trail Blazers rank among the National Basketball Association’s most prominent franchises, featuring a championship pedigree that reaches back to 1977 when the team secured its sole NBA title. That successful campaign made Portland a destination for basketball excellence and formed a foundation of sporting pride that has endured across generations of supporters. The franchise’s early achievements, paired with its focus on developing homegrown talent, garnered the Trail Blazers a loyal supporter base renowned throughout the league for their enthusiastic support and allegiance to the organisation.

Despite the title glory of the late 1970s, the Trail Blazers have faced significant challenges in recovering that level of sustained success in the years that followed. The ongoing campaign exemplifies the challenges confronting the organisation, with the team navigating both competitive struggles and substantial off-court issues. Head coach Chauncey Billups’s indefinite suspension resulting from an FBI investigation into unlawful wagering and purportedly fixed, organised crime-connected card games has caused substantial upheaval. Under interim coach Tiago Splitter’s leadership, however, the Trail Blazers are well-placed to compete in the play-in tournament for post-season qualification, offering hope for a fresh beginning under new ownership.
